Peterhof - Russian Versailles (Pre-book and Save $10*)
Peterhof, the town of palaces, fountains and parks, was built by Peter the Great to rival Versailles. It lies on the southern shore of the Gulf of Finland, 22 miles west of ... more
Peterhof, the town of palaces, fountains and parks, was built by Peter the Great to rival Versailles. It lies on the southern shore of the Gulf of Finland, 22 miles west of St. Petersburg. After a short walk from the parking lot you’ll reach the main entrance of the Grand Palace. Built in the beginning of the 18th century, Peterhof is known as the most brilliant of all the summer residences of the Russian Tsars. The estate construction spanned two centuries, and upon its completion it encompassed seven parks and more than 20 smaller palaces and pavilions. Peter himself designed the layout of the 300-acre park and spectacular fountains.
During World War II, the estate was occupied and all the buildings and fountains were completely demolished. Peterhof is also a monument to Soviet reconstruction, as the place was looted and practically razed to the ground by Nazi troops. For many years the palace and the Grand Cascade were under extensive restoration. Now all guests of the city can enjoy the spectacular views of the palace.

Best of Naples - Pompeii, Archaeological Museum & Pizza
Link the pieces of the puzzle when you visit Pompeii’s ruins together with its uncovered history and treasures housed at the archaeological museum. Experience the 'original ... more
Link the pieces of the puzzle when you visit Pompeii’s ruins together with its uncovered history and treasures housed at the archaeological museum. Experience the 'original pizza' in the city that boasts the world's first pizzeria, dating back to 1830, and see the sites of Naples. Travel along the coast with magnificent views of the Bay of Naples and Mt. Vesuvius - the still-active volcano that buried Pompeii in 79 A.D. - in the backdrop. At the ruins of Pompeii, you'll discover the archaeological excavations of a lost city buried deep beneath the ash from Mt. Vesuvius. Entering by the sea gate, your walking tour takes in the city's baths, villas, theaters and wrestling grounds. Plaster casts mark the positions of the fallen that were swiftly overcome by volcanic ash. Your guide will point out the remarkably preserved remains that hint at daily Roman life, their customs, cuisine and how they entertained, decorated and lived. Highlights include stunning frescoes and elaborately detailed mosaic-inlaid floors of wealthy homeowners' villas, as Pompeii was a vacation community for high society. On the way back to Naples, you’ll stop at a cameo factory where artisans have honed their craft for generations. You'll have some time to shop for handmade seashell and coral jewelry, including intricately carved brooches, rings and bracelets. Sit back and enjoy classic Pizza Margherita at a typical Neapolitan pizzeria accompanied by a mixed green salad and beverage. Before heading to our next stop, take a sightseeing loop around the city for a quick orientation, driving past the round-towered Castel Nuovo, San Carlo Opera House, Umberto Gallery, the Royal Palace and San Francesco di Paola Church. Driving along the waterfront, notice the site where Naples was first founded: Castel dell'Ovo or 'egg castle'. Its curious name comes from a Roman legend that claimed the castle was built over an egg placed on the site with the belief that if the egg broke Naples would fall. Visit The National Archaeological Museum next. Originally cavalry barracks, Charles of Bourbon established the museum in the late 18th century to house the fantastic Farnese Collection that he had inherited. Highlights include the Farnese Bull and a classical Roman sculpture depicting figures from Greek mythology. The museum houses a collection of murals, frescoes and mosaics from Pompeii and Herculaneum. Note: The tour doesn't operate on Tuesdays. Dolmabahce Palace & Grand Bazaar
This exclusive tour is an opportunity to travel in a small group to see the latest palace of Istanbul as well as enjoy some shopping in the bazaar and exploration in the new ... more
This exclusive tour is an opportunity to travel in a small group to see the latest palace of Istanbul as well as enjoy some shopping in the bazaar and exploration in the new city. Start your day with the highlight of the tour, Dolmabahce Palace, through the Imperial gate. Built in 1856, the palace sits on 62 acres and consists of 285 rooms and 46 halls. The most notable sites include the crystal staircase made of Baccarat crystal and the ceremonial hall which was designed to hold 2,500 people. Then, continue to the Grand Bazaar, composed of two sections: the covered part and the modern part. The covered part is a whole quarter on its own and is surrounded by a wall which can be entered through several gates. The maze of streets and lanes are one of the greatest sights in the city, where various trades such as carpets, jewelry, leather goods, silver; varieties of souvenirs, textile, antiques, and home textile are segregated into particular sections of the bazaar. You'll have the chance to explore the exotic atmosphere of the covered part for a brief period of time. You'll also have the opportunity to visit the open and modern section of the Grand Bazaar which offers the best artworks and most reliable shopping. During your time around the bazaar, you'll be taken for a presentation on the unique art of Turkish carpets and be given additional time to shop. Enjoy some complimentary refreshments while you shop and stroll in the handicraft store. Conclude your day in Taksim, where the city is alive and bustling 24 hours a day.
